Background
The Department of Veterans Affairs, Network Contracting Office 19, is seeking potential sources for an agreement to provide Fire Pump Inspection, Testing and Maintenance Services for the Western Colorado VA Health Care System (VAHCS) located in Grand Junction, CO. This initiative aims to ensure compliance with fire code safety requirements and maintain the reliability of the fire pump system at the facility. The contract will involve qualified sources classified under various business categories.

Work Details
The contractor shall provide all labor, supervision, tools, equipment, materials, and expertise necessary to complete the following tasks:

1. **Monthly Inspection and Testing (CLIN 1001)**: Conduct monthly inspections and testing of the fire pump system in compliance with NFPA 25. This includes reporting deficiencies that pose safety risks and providing a written field service report within 10 business days after service.

2. **Annual Testing (CLIN 1002)**: Perform annual inspections and testing of the fire pump system while ensuring compliance with NFPA 25 and OSHA standards. Similar reporting requirements apply as in CLIN 1001.

3. **Repair and Maintenance (CLIN 1003)**: Invoice for approved expenses related to repairs and maintenance of the fire pump system. All parts must meet manufacturer requirements and carry a minimum one-year warranty. Emergency response must be provided within specified timeframes.

The contractor must ensure that all work adheres to applicable codes, standards, and regulations while maintaining quality control throughout the process.

Place of Performance
The services will be performed at the Western Colorado VA Health Care System located at 2121 North Avenue, Grand Junction, CO 81501.
